Another stressful experiment by Gaspar Noé. 'Vortex' is a dramatic downward spiral of frustration and hopelessness. Dario Argento impresses as an old man trying to live many lives simultaneously despite his age.

But it is Françoise Lebrun who gives the most striking and somber performance by playing an old woman lost in the shadow of dementia. 'Vortex' sure plays some of the same notes as 'The Father,' but the tone is cruder.

Noé draws upon some visual resources to exasperate the viewer — is the split screen format diabolically trying to look like a film frame? — creating a sense of confusion and discomfort. It's like 'Climax' but slowed down to the minimum level, with some Haneke's 'Amour' elements in there.

My only complaint is the excessive runtime and the feeling that everything gets repetitive very quickly, but I guess that was his intent.
